MINUTES OF PROCEEDINGS

Meeting No. 123

Tuesday, October 6, 1998

The Standing Committee on Finance met at 9:12 a.m. this day, in St. John's, Newfoundland, the Vice-Chair, Nick Discepola, presiding.

Members of the Committee present: Scott Brison, Nick Discepola, Gary Pillitteri, Karen Redman and Paul Szabo.

Acting Members present: Paul Forseth for Monte Solberg; Lorne Nystrom for Nelson Riis.

In attendance: From the Library of Parliament: Richard Domingue, Researcher.

Witnesses: From the Insurance Brokers Association of Newfoundland Inc.: John P. Thompson, President; Jeff Wedgewood, Secretary; Brian Flemming, Treasurer; From the Royal Bank of Newfoundland and Labrador: Sam Walters, Vice-President.

In accordance with its mandate under Standing Order 108(2), the Committee resumed its study of the Report of the Task Force on the future of the Canadian Financial Services Sector. (See Minutes of Proceedings dated Tuesday, May 26, 1998, Meeting No. 87).

Sam Walters and John P. Thompson made statements and, with Jeff Wedgewood and Brian Flemming, answered questions.

At 11:25 a.m., the Committee adjourned to the call of the Chair.
